Calhoun County reported a combined STD rate of 752.4 per 100,000 residents in 2023, placing it 33rd of 67 Alabama counties — in the upper half of the state. Reported infections included chlamydia at 547.1 per 100,000 (637 cases, 16% below the state rate), gonorrhea at 193.3 per 100,000 (225 cases, 15% below the state rate), syphilis at 12.0 per 100,000 (14 cases, 58% below the state rate).
